How to make this the best Chipotle Aioli

  • Use avocado mayo! The mayo is the base of this creamy, luscious sauce. By choosing  a healthier option with healthy monounsaturated fats and antioxidants, not only will it taste amazing, but it’ll also add some nutrients that you, your family, and anyone you share it with can benefit from. Plus, avocado mayo has the best buttery flavor—you’re going to love it in this recipe.

  • Use a reduced-sugar strawberry jam. I love Smucker's Reduced Sugar Strawberry Fruit Spread. It’s sweet enough without adding too much sugar to the sauce. The natural sweetness, combined with just a little sugar, balances out the spiciness from the chipotle peppers. It’s the perfect way to create that sweet-to-heat balance. And it’s a little healthier too!

  • Taste and adjust! I don’t give an exact amount for salt or pepper because it’s best to taste the sauce as you go to get the seasoning just right. After all, you’re the one eating it, so it should be customized to your taste. This goes for any sauce you make—taste as you go so you don’t make it too spicy, sweet, acidic, creamy, or salty. Blend, then adjust the flavor to create the perfect sauce for your next meal!

Ingredients: 

  • Chipotle Peppers

  • Mayo

  • Strawberry Jam

  • Lime Juice

  • Garlic Powder

  • Salt & Pepper

Ingredients for strawberry and chipotle mayo, including strawberry jam, lime, mayonnaise, and chipotle peppers in adobo sauce.

How to Make this Strawberry & Chipotle Aioli

  1. In a small (personal) blender, place 1–2 chipotle peppers in adobo sauce from a can — 1 for a milder flavor, 2 for extra spice. Add 1 cup of your preferred mayo, ½ tablespoon lime juice, ½ teaspoon garlic powder, and a light pinch of salt and pepper.

  2. Blend thoroughly until smooth and creamy — everything should come together into a bright, smoky, and spicy sauce. 🌶️

  3. Taste test time! Adjust to your liking:

    Too spicy? ➜ Add more mayo.

    Want it sweeter? ➜ Mix in a little more strawberry jam. 🍓

    Need more tang? ➜ Add an extra squeeze of lime juice. 🍋

  4. Once you’ve perfected your flavor, transfer the sauce to a refrigerator-safe container. Chill and enjoy on sandwiches, salads, tacos, wraps — or honestly, anything you want. 😉
